Cottage cheese casserole

Ingredients

  • Cheese

    300 g

  • Chicken egg

    4 piece

  • Corn flour

    0.5 cup

  • Vanilla

    1 pack

  • Sugar

    0.5 cup

  • Leavening agent

    1 tsp

  • Raisins

    0.5 cup

  • Walnuts

    0.5 cup

  • Apple

    1 piece

  • Almonds

    0.5 cup

  • Butter

    1 tsp

  • Sour cream

    1 Tbsp

  • Cream

    50 ml

  • Grapes

Cooking

Apologies, but photos of the beginning process! Eggs, sugar, sour cream, cream, vanilla - massage into lather! Add the cheese and grind in a blender. Flour mixed with baking powder and combine with cottage cheese mixture. Add the raisins, of course washed and dried, and the flour dusted! And I forgot again! Walnuts chop with a knife, singing a song! Everything in the bowl with the mixture.

Form for baking grease with butter and showered with almonds! The beauty of falling leaves!

Cut into pieces-leaves Apple. We spread it on the bottom and sides of the form. To be honest, after baking this ornament nobody noticed, well, okay, but the process went beautifully!

Pour the cheesecake mixture into the mold. On top of the grapes and almonds! All! Everything goes in the oven for 40 minutes at 170 degrees.
